Kompiler : diforc'h etre ar stummoù
Adkas war-du Kempuner Tikedenn : Adkas nevez |
Dizober kemmoù 1857609 a-berzh 2.14.54.118 (kaozeal) Tikedennoù : Adkas dilamet Dizober |
||
Linenn 1: | Linenn 1: | ||
Ur '''c’hompiler''', pe ur '''c'hempuner''', a zo ur meziant a dro ur [[program]] eus e stumm mammenn — un destenn — d’ur stumm binarel a c’hell bezañ peurgaset gant un [[urzhiataer]], peurliesañ dindan kontroll ur [[reizhiad korvoiñ]] resis. |
|||
#ADKAS [[Kempuner]] |
|||
== Labour ur c’hompiler == |
|||
=== Dielfennerezh geriadurel === |
|||
Da gentañ e vez lennet pep arouez er vammenn. Strollet e vez an arouezoù e jetoueroù. Da skouer, el linnen-mañ: |
|||
<kbd> |
|||
frouezh = avaloù + perennoù |
|||
</kbd> |
|||
Strollet eo <kbd>f</kbd>, <kbd>r</kbd>, <kbd>o</kbd>, <kbd>u</kbd>, <kbd>e</kbd>, <kbd>z</kbd>, <kbd>h</kbd> evit sevel ar jetouer <kbd>frouezh</kbd>. |
|||
=== Dielfennezezh sintaksel === |
|||
Strollet eo ar jetoueroù, « gerioù » ar program, evit ober « frazennoù » a c’hell bezañ peurgaset gant un urzhiataer. Gant ar memes skouer eo savet un heuliad oberiadurioù : sammañ <kbd>avaloù</kbd> ha <kbd>perennoù</kbd>, lakaat an disoc’h e <kbd>frouezh</kbd>. |
|||
=== Gwiriañ an tipoù === |
|||
Rankout a ra tipoù ar variennoù bezañ kempoell. Er skouer a-üs e rank <kbd>avaloù</kbd> ha <kbd>perennoù</kbd> bezañ niveroù, ha n’eo ket, da skouer, chadennoù (variennoù a zo testennoù enno). |
|||
=== Produiñ kod binarel === |
|||
Troet eo ar frazennoù da god binarel a ra gant kement urzhioù a c’hell an urzhiataer hag ar reizhiad korvoiñ peurgas. |
|||
=== Gwellaat ar c’hod === |
|||
Dielfenn a ra ar c’hompiler ar c’hod binarel evit klask lakaat tammoù kod efedusoc’h e lec’h ar re produet e penn kentañ. |
|||
== Lennadur == |
|||
* {{en}} ''Compilers: Principles, Techniques, and Tools'', Alfred V. Aho, Monica S. Lam, Ravi Sethi, Jeffrey D. Ullman, Pearson Education, Inc., 2006. |
|||
[[Rummad:Urzhiataerezh]] |
Stumm red eus an 26 Du 2019 da 21:35
Ur c’hompiler, pe ur c'hempuner, a zo ur meziant a dro ur program eus e stumm mammenn — un destenn — d’ur stumm binarel a c’hell bezañ peurgaset gant un urzhiataer, peurliesañ dindan kontroll ur reizhiad korvoiñ resis.
Labour ur c’hompiler[kemmañ | kemmañ ar vammenn]
Dielfennerezh geriadurel[kemmañ | kemmañ ar vammenn]
Da gentañ e vez lennet pep arouez er vammenn. Strollet e vez an arouezoù e jetoueroù. Da skouer, el linnen-mañ:
frouezh = avaloù + perennoù
Strollet eo f, r, o, u, e, z, h evit sevel ar jetouer frouezh.
Dielfennezezh sintaksel[kemmañ | kemmañ ar vammenn]
Strollet eo ar jetoueroù, « gerioù » ar program, evit ober « frazennoù » a c’hell bezañ peurgaset gant un urzhiataer. Gant ar memes skouer eo savet un heuliad oberiadurioù : sammañ avaloù ha perennoù, lakaat an disoc’h e frouezh.
Gwiriañ an tipoù[kemmañ | kemmañ ar vammenn]
Rankout a ra tipoù ar variennoù bezañ kempoell. Er skouer a-üs e rank avaloù ha perennoù bezañ niveroù, ha n’eo ket, da skouer, chadennoù (variennoù a zo testennoù enno).
Produiñ kod binarel[kemmañ | kemmañ ar vammenn]
Troet eo ar frazennoù da god binarel a ra gant kement urzhioù a c’hell an urzhiataer hag ar reizhiad korvoiñ peurgas.
Gwellaat ar c’hod[kemmañ | kemmañ ar vammenn]
Dielfenn a ra ar c’hompiler ar c’hod binarel evit klask lakaat tammoù kod efedusoc’h e lec’h ar re produet e penn kentañ.
Lennadur[kemmañ | kemmañ ar vammenn]
- (en) Compilers: Principles, Techniques, and Tools, Alfred V. Aho, Monica S. Lam, Ravi Sethi, Jeffrey D. Ullman, Pearson Education, Inc., 2006.